Brush Box 41-2 Crapo Rd
 
By Firefighter Kevin Carr
October 11, 2019
 

At 1309hrs Dorchester Central dispatched Station 1 units to assist on A "WOODS FIRE" at CRAPO POST OFFICE @2568 LAKESVILLE CRAPO RD in the Lakes & Straits Box Area 41-2. Command (Forestry) advised all responding units to be cautious as it was high tide and roads leading to the fire were washed out. Engine 1-3 responded at 1310hrs with a crew of 3 and arrived on location at 1338hrs to assist Special Unit 46-1 extinguish an RV fire, complete overhaul and clean up. Other crews (Forestry, & Blackwater) cut A line through the woods to cut off the fire. At 1426hrs with the RV extinguished and a line cut around the woods fire command released Station 1 (Cambridge), 66 (Taylors Island) & 500 (Madison PM) units to return to service. All units cleared the scene and returned to service without incident.

 
Units: Station 41
 
Mutual Aid: Engine 1-3, Brush 1-1, Forestry Fire, Blackwater Fire, Special Unit 46-1, Brush 46-1, Tanker 46, Brush 56-1, Tanker 56, Tanker 66-1
